About the 32 bit board...

I have build my corexy printer using an ramps 1.4 board and overall it works.
After some time, decided to buy an 32 bit board because i have problems of micro stop when my full graphic lcd was connected to the ramps. All my prints have little blobs because of this microstops and the external walls was not very good. After more testing i decided to complete disconnect the lcd from the ramps and only print from the SD card reader. This have give me the best result and i have good results.
I receive and installed my radds board, after making my first print with the new board i noticed the result are like night to day. The board have made an big improvement in the overall print quality, this improvement was much superior i was expecting.

Most people think wrongly this 32 bit board are only useful to deltas printer or if you want to print fast. The main vantage you gain and i was not expecting is the speed and movement constant of the print.

Resuming all this talk: if the goal of building your printer is to make an good printing machine, them an 32 bit board is a must. With an ramps board you never get the full potential of your printer. The igus bearing or dampers are nice to have but will not make any difference in the print quality, the board will make a big one.
